
Senior Data Engineer
- Tempe, AZ
- Permanent
- Full-time
- Design, implement, and optimize data models, ensuring they align with business reporting needs and best practices.
- Collaborate with data engineers to define and enhance ELT pipelines, ensuring efficient data ingestion and transformation.
- Leverage Artificial Intelligence and other emerging technologies to create innovative, modern data solutions.
- Use Python to automate data transformations, build quality checks, and optimize Snowflake performance.
- Support data governance initiatives, including metadata management and lineage tracking.
- Monitor and improve query performance and cost efficiency within Snowflake.
- Implement data quality checks, testing frameworks, and documentation to ensure trust in reporting and analytics.
- Work closely with analysts and business teams to understand data needs and optimize models for self-service analytics.
- Self-starter with the ability to work independently, collaborate within a team, and engage cross-functionally.
- 7+ years of experience in engineering data integrations, analytics engineering, and data modeling.
- Bachelor's degree in Computer Science, Engineering, or related field.
- Extensive experience in design and delivery incorporating a strong focus on stability and scalability.
- Proficiency in working with Snowflake, Kafka, Argo, on-premises SQL Server, and SSIS, along with a solid understanding of cloud-based data technologies.
- Strong programming skills in languages utilized for data engineering such as Python, SQL, Java, and Scala with experience in scripting, automation, and data manipulation.
- Excellent communication and collaboration skills, with the ability to effectively interact with technical and non-technical stakeholders.
- Familiarity with NoSQL and other non-relational concepts, DBT core, Argo and Kafka is a plus.
- Experience working with BI tools such as Sigma and Tableau is a plus.
- Strong analytical mindset with excellent problem-solving and communication skills.
- Work From Home. Feel free to rock the casual wear while still being camera ready. You will be working from your home office (in an approved city & state) and make sure you have a conducive and quiet workspace with no distractions and reliable and secure internet.
- Medical, dental, and vision, oh my! DriveTime Family of Brands covers a sizable amount of insurance premiums to ensure our employees receive top-tier healthcare coverage.
- But Wait, There’s More. 401(K), Company paid life insurance policy, short and long-term disability coverage to name a few.
- Growth Opportunities. You grow, I grow, we all grow! But seriously, DriveTime Family of Brands is committed to providing its employees with every opportunity to grow professionally with roughly over 1,000 employees promoted year over year.
- Tuition Reimbursement. We’re as passionate about your professional development as you are. With that, we’ll put our money where our mouth is.
- Wellness Program. Health is wealth! This program includes self-guided coaching and journeys, cash incentives and discounts on your medical premiums through engaging in fun activities!
- Gratitude is Green. We offer competitive pay across the organization, because, well… money matters!
- Paid Time Off. Not just lip service: we work hard, to play hard! Paid time off includes (for all full-time roles) wellness days, holidays, and good ole' fashioned YOU time! For our Part-timers, don't fear you get some time too...vacation time is available - the more you work, the more you earn!